DAY 2: BUCHAREST - TULCEA- This morning we explore Bucharest on foot. Here we have the opportunity to stroll tree- lined boulevards and discover the fantastic architecture on offer, such as the extravagant Palace of Parliament and the city's many monasteries and orthodox churches. This afternoon we take the train to Tulcea, gateway to the Danube Delta. ( B) DAY 3: DANUBE DELTA- Today we take a cruise on the Danube Delta, a World Heritage Site and renowned for its fantastic scenery and superb wildlife. Later we drive back to Bucharest and take the overnight train to Suceava. ( B) DAY 4: SUCEAVA- We have a full day excursion to visit the various monasteries and painted churches that are found in this region. Later we take the train to Cluj Napoca. DAY 5: CLUJ NAPOCA- This one time capital of Transylvania is now a major university town, which gives the town a laid back ambience in which to admire its fantastic Baroque architecture. We have time to explore the various sites such as St Michael's church, dating back to the 14th century, and the National History Museum of Transylvania. In the evening we take the train to Sighisoara. ( B) DAY 6: SIGHISOARA- We wander the cobbled streets of this perfectly preserved mediaeval town, one of the most important towns in Transylvania during the Roman Empire, before moving on to Brasov. ( B) DAY 7: BRASOV- A full day in Brasov, a very popular destination with a magnificent central square, which is awash with cosmopolitan outdoor cafes and baroque facades. ( B) DAY 8: BRAN CASTLE- We hike through picturesque scenery and villages to Bran Castle and visit this well preserved building, also known as Dracula's Castle. Later we travel to Sinaia. ( B) DAY 9: SINAIA- Spend time discovering this picturesque town, which is considered to be one of the most beautiful mountain resorts in Romania. We then return to Bucharest.
